OnClientFileUploadRemoving

Updated on Aug 24, 2026

The OnClientFileUploadRemoving occurs before the file is about to be removed from the FileListPanel. The event can be cancelled.

The event handler receives two parameters:

  1. The instance of the RadCloudUpload control firing the event.

  2. An eventArgs parameter containing the following methods:

  • set_cancel lets you prevent the row from being deleted.

  • get_fileName the name of the file that is about to be removed from the uploaded files collection.

  • get_row returns the row containing the file input field for the file that is just about to be removed (<LI> element)

  • get_isFailed returns a boolean value, specifying if the file, which is about to be removed had passed the validation.

ASP.NET
<telerik:RadCloudUpload runat="server" ID="RadCloudUpload1" OnClientFileUploadRemoving="onClientFileUploadRemoving" ...>
</telerik:RadCloudUpload>
JavaScript
function onClientFileUploadRemoving(sender, eventArgs) {
	if (eventArgs.get_fileName().length > "10") {
		alert("Cannot delete files, which name's length is larger then 10 symbols");
		eventArgs.set_cancel(true);
	}

}
